Output 008521fe3587fad15aca3c27513c24ede7ec65898945fa89368917fd0a603984:0

value
2692021083
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9a0b4053be582847fc41a7d3701b5ff48b91cac OP_EQUALVERIFY OP_CHECKSIG
address
1GTuiGswvdFGna1H9SGDKArgGVZHQmtPCk
transaction
008521fe3587fad15aca3c27513c24ede7ec65898945fa89368917fd0a603984
spent
true